The Missouri Valley Conference Tournament will be held March 3-6 from the Enterprise Center in St. Louis, Missouri.

Northern Iowa enters as the No. 1 seed, and the winner of the bracket will receive an automatic bid to the 2022 NCAA Tournament. No. 4 Loyola-Chicago is the defending champion of this event as they defeated Drake in a matchup between the top two seeds in last year’s tournament title game.

2022 MVC Tournament: Date, time, TV, live stream

Thursday, March 3

Game 1: No. 9 Indiana State 53, No. 8 Illinois State 58
Game 2: No. 10 Evansville 59, No. 7 Valparaiso 81

Friday, March 4

Game 3: No. 8 Illinois State 65, No. 1 Northern Iowa 78
Game 4: No. 5 Bradley 50, No. 4 Loyola-Chicago 66
Game 5: No. 7 Valparaiso 58, No. 2 Missouri State 67
Game 6: No. 6 SIU 52, No. 3 Drake 65

Saturday, March 5

Game 7: No. 4 Loyola-Chicago 66, No. 1 Northern Iowa 43
Game 8: No. 3 Drake vs. No. 2 Missouri State, 6:00 p.m. ET, CBS Sports Network

Sunday, March 6 Final

Game 9: No. 4 Loyola-Chicago vs. Winner of Game 8, 2:00 p.m. ET, CBS
